Our Story

Wine Sarom and her husband, Hoeurn Siha, live with their youngest child; a 16 year old who has not finished school because he has had to start working to support the three of them – a sad reality for many children in Cambodia. They receive food from the pagoda (more specifically, the Buddhist vihara, or monastery) because Dad only makes $1 USD a day working in construction, which can be extremely sporadic hours.

Dad’s eyesight is completely gone and while it could be restored with surgery, and they have even found a way to pay for the medical bills, they simply cannot afford the travel and hotel costs to stay in Phnom Penh for the procedure! They are in a small amount of debt, and are eager to leave the slum by the river east of SALT School where they currently live. Their five adult children live nearby and do what they can to help and Wine Sarom hopes for a day where they can all find a place to live closer together. The family are Christians.
